Grady Sizemore Baseball player

Grady Sizemore III (born August 2, 1982) is an American professional baseball outfielder for the Philadelphia Phillies of Major League Baseball (MLB). Sizemore played in MLB for the Cleveland Indians from 2004 through 2011, but did not play in the majors for the following two years after back and knee injuries. He is a three-time MLB All-Star and a two-time Gold Glove Award winner. He also won a Silver Slugger Award.
